About Us

EPUT provides community health, mental health and learning disability services to support more than 3.2 million people living across Bedfordshire, Essex and Suffolk. Also:

  • We are among the largest employers in the East of England region, with more than 10,000 staff working across more than 200 sites.
  • We run the COVID-19 vaccination programme across mid and south Essex and Suffolk and north east Essex.

EPUT was formed on 1 April 2017 following the merger of North Essex Partnership University NHS Foundation Trust (NEP) and South Essex Partnership University NHS Foundation Trust (SEPT). A new leadership team was established at the Trust in 2020.

Job overview

12 month - Maternity Cover (Fixed Term / Secondment from June 2025 - June 2026)

The successful applicant will be responsible for the daily management of a mixed assessment ward within Basildon Mental Health Unit.

The post holder is responsible for overseeing assessments of care needs and the development, implementation and evaluation of programmes of care for clients with mental health needs. Participate in ward meetings, initiating and discussing new methods/models of care and the introduction to research or trials within a designated area. Ensure the environment is maintained to high standards at all times. Ensure all CQC standards are upheld at all times and the information is disseminated to all staff.

Detailed job description and main responsibilities

Key strategic responsibilities

  1. In liaison with the Consultant Practitioner/Clinical Manager, set objectives for the delivery of care, and the implementation and monitoring.
  2. Responsible for updating own knowledge and ensuring all Mandatory and Core Practice Training is up to date at all times.
  3. Ensure full compliance with standards laid out in the Trust's CPA Policy is in place at all times. Upholding the principle for Admission Procedure is undertaken in accordance with CPA and Trust Policy, risk assessed and that discharges are pre-planned, and that all necessary agencies are informed.
  4. In line with the Trust's visions uphold all principles of good 'customer care' including members of the public, other professionals, patients and colleagues on the ward.
  5. Act at all times in accordance with: Midwifery and Nursing Council Code of Professional Practice 2015, Scope of Professional Practice, Standards for Medicines management 2008, Guidelines for Records and Record Keeping 2015, Revalidation from 2016.
  6. In liaison with the Consultant Practitioner/Clinical Manager, ensure that Essex Partnership University Foundation NHS Trust Policies and Procedures are communicated, implemented and developed and that all staff are aware of the procedure to obtain all Policies and Procedure via the Trust Intranet web site.
  7. Inform the Consultant Practitioner on all breaches of nursing professional conduct as required by the NMC code of Professional Practice.
  8. Work closely with the Executive Nurse in developing nursing practice across the ward.
